I can really appreciate this book for what it is, but once again, Stephen Graham Jones's writing is a little too introspective and dreamlike for me. I gravitate to a more literal, concrete storytelling style and because of this I kept getting confused about movement and logistics, especially in the beginning. That said, I did like this a lot better than The Only Good Indians.
